Shopify API: Main Facts You Need To Know About It in 2022

Nataliia Kovalchuk
5 min readMay 10, 2022


shopify api

Because eCommerce apps and services can only access data from e-stores if connected to the shopping platform they are based on, they have to integrate with them. One of the most popular and widespread shopping platforms among e-sellers is Shopify. To get access to the data from online stores built on this platform, software providers need to connect to its API (Application Programming Interface). APIs are used by developers to manage and store data for their software needs.

Shopify is a leading eCommerce platform that hosts 1 million+ online stores with no less than $7 billion worth of sales. Its popularity is highest in the United States (921,000+ e-stores), followed by the United Kingdom (50,000+ e-stores), Australia (38,000+ e-stores) and Canada (29,000+ e-stores). It is a good customer bank for B2B software vendors who want to help e-merchants organize and get more out of their e-stores.

In this article, we will explore all the details connected with the API of Shopify. We will discover how to develop Shopify API integration.

Shopify API Meaning

API is a software intermediary between two applications, which allows them to communicate with each other. Without APIs, you would have to learn how each application was implemented in order to communicate with it. Because APIs integrate application components into existing architectures, they allow business and IT teams to work together.

Let’s look at how Shopify API works and what it can do. t Iis a tool that allows software developers to access data from Shopify-based online stores and use it in their own software and applications.

The API of Shopify supports both XML and JSON, and works with such types of the HTTP requests as GET, POST, PUT, and DELETE. An interesting issue is the methods supported by the Shopify. The methods include Category, Customer, Order, Product, and more. Each method has a purpose it can be used for and certain properties.

Shopify regularly updates its API. For eCommerce software and app providers who want to work with Shopify data, it is important to closely monitor what version of the API of Shopify is relevant. If the app providers or developers fail to do so, they will not be able to maintain a constant and reliable API connection.

In April 2020, Shopify made the latest changes to its API by replacing page-based pagination with cursor-based pagination. The change was introduced in version 2019–07 of the API and above. It caused many difficulties for app developers who work with the API of Shopify and need access to e-stores info.

Shopify API Integration

Shopify integration enables software providers and developers to tie any application with Shopify’s shopping platform. It is necessary for those software providers who want to offer their services to online retailers who use Shopify for selling their goods online.

Without the development of reliable Shopify API integration, software providers cannot assist e-store owners in organizing and automating their e-retail processes.

For instance, if you are a shipping software developer who wants to import orders from Shopify-based stores, first you need to build a connection between your software and this platform. In the other case, you won’t be able to filter orders, create shipments, generate shipping labels and update order statuses. The development of Shopify integration can bring a lot of benefits to eCommerce software solutions. It enables them to propose their services to a greater number of e-retailers. Also, it allows them to expand their market share as Shopify is popular worldwide.

How to Develop a Reliable Integration with Shopify API Easily

Developing API integration Shopify is a complex process that may require months of investigation and preparation. Even after its development, you must be prepared to maintain it and upgrade it as necessary.

But there is a solution that can help you integrate your B2B software with Shopify easily. It’s API2Cart — the unified interface for shopping platform integration. With its help, you can get the list of orders, products, and customers from Shopify e-stores, update order info, retrieve tax info, add and update shipments, etc.

API2Cart is a service for Shopify API integration that simplifies the process for software vendors who want to work with Shopify data. Among its users are developers of software for shipping management, order and inventory management, ERP systems, repricing and price optimization, marketing automation tools, POS systems, dropshipping automation and others.

Why Choose API2Cart for Shopify Integration Setting

API2Cart provides advanced Shopify integration over and above in-house development. First of all, API2Cart has already developed dozens of shopping platform integrations. Moreover, the service continuously upgrades all of them. So, you won’t need to take care of further Shopify connection maintenance and support.

Secondly, Shopify integration via API2Cart may save you money and time. If Shopify API integration is developed in-house, then it may cost thousands of dollars. How is this possible? Just imagine that you have to pay salaries to your developer team for setting the connection. The work of qualified specialists can cost approximately 4000–6000$ per month. Moreover, don’t forget about the money required for various services that should use your developers. It includes tools like CS (code repository), CI/CD Services, Cloud Services, etc. Also, server hardware and application hosting expenses also are unavoidable.

In addition, API2Cart provides more than 100 API methods for managing data from Shopify e-stores. You’ll be able to access all the needed info on orders, shipments, products, customers, and shipments easily.

In addition, API2Cart has detailed API documentation and 24/7 technical support.


The Shopify API is a helpful tool for building bridges between you and the data you need. As useful and usable as it is today, the API of Shopify will always be in demand.

API2Cart may be your solution for some difficulties encountered in the integration developing process. It fully integrates with Shopify, enabling you to reach all of the necessary data and perform various operations with products, orders, categories, etc.

Shopify is not the only shopping platform API2Cart works with. In fact, it is integrated with more than 40 platforms and marketplaces. The list includes BigCommerce, Magento, WooCommerce, OpenCart, Amazon, Etsy and eBay. If you need to deal with more than one shopping platform integration development, consider using API2Cart service. It is an easy and time-saving way out.

For more details about how API2Cart works, please refer to its API Documentation. If you would like to try the service, simply register for an account and add any of your clients’ e-stores based on Shopify. After that, you will be able to view all necessary data on orders, products, and prices. If you still have questions regarding Shopify integration or API2Cart service in general, you can contact its managers at